How can you tell if a project has bad documentation?
Filed under Software on December 2nd, 2007
It’s documentation is based on a wiki.
It’s documentation is based on a wiki.
Tony Celeste reports for Tom’s Guide:
This is something I never thought I’d hear myself say - or maybe I should say, see myself type - about an Apple operating system: Mac OSX Leopard was released before it was ready. This operating system needed more testing on more systems with more hardware, and especially, more software configurations.
Don’t they all? In order to release you have to draw a line somewhere.
It’s like hack articles. You know it’s not 100% ready (far from it), you know that the arguments are lame, but you go and post it anyway. Well, Tony did.
The days of Apple computers operating with just the Mac OS and Adobe Photoshop installed, and practically nothing else to speak of, are long gone, and Apple knows this as well as anyone.
Emmm, when exactly were those days?
Perhaps the most troublesome of the problems has been a data loss issue caused by Finder, which performs a function on Macs similar to that of Explorer in Windows. In Leopard, when Finder moves a file from one drive to another, it deletes the file from the originating hard drive, without first checking to see if the file arrived safely on the destination hard drive. If anything goes wrong during the file transfer, such as a momentary power glitch on the destination hard drive, the file would then be destroyed on both hard drives.
While it sure is a nasty bug, is this the “most troublesome of problems” that you can come up with?
Actually the bug existed long before Leopard. It never was any real trouble because at its peak popularity the move feature was used by, let’s make a guess here, 5 people worldwide. It surely wasn’t an advertised feature anywhere in the interface. Very few people knew about it, and fewer used it. If this is the “most troublesome of problems” then Leopard must be a fine release.
Leopard users hoped that a free maintenance update (OSX 10.5.1), released on Thursday, November 15, would fix the issue, but Apple’s statement accompanying the update is too vague to give a definitive answer. With regard to data loss, it states that “… a potential data loss issue when moving files across partitions …” has been fixed, but moving files across hard drives is not addressed. Personally, I wouldn’t want to bet my important data on that statement.
And I, personally, wouldn’t want to get my software news and critique from hack articles such as this.
What’s with the FUD on Apple’s phrasing? Couldn’t bother to test it yourself? Couldn’t bother to even do a quick google on it?
In an unrelated issue, data recovery firm Retrodata has found a disturbing hard drive failure rate in some Apple Macbooks. Quoting from the Retrodata Web site: “We at Retrodata believe that any sizeable manufacturer would by this stage be aware of such a problem and issue a product recall notice, or an offer to have the drive exchanged for a suitable alternative at their own expense.” If you own an Apple Macbook with a Seagate hard drive, I strongly suggest you check out the details available at Retrodata.
And this is related to Leopard how exactly?
You got me there buddy. I thought the “in an unrelated issue” was reffering to the issue being unrelated to the previous issue, not to the article’s topic altogether. Nifty way to introduce non sequiturs. In an unrelated issue, I am, in fact, a dolly made of wood.
As disturbing as data loss is, this next problem is the Apple version of a bombshell. Thanks to Leopard, the dreaded Blue Screen of Death is now a part of the Mac operating system. When I first tell this to Mac users that haven’t yet upgraded to Leopard, I usually hear something like “Yeah, I get Blue Screens of Death when I use Windows on my Mac”. No, that’s not quite what I mean - Blue Screens of Death are occurring not only in Windows, but in Leopard as well. The problem, to a certain extent, has been acknowledged by Apple.
Nicely put Tony. You only forgot a little detail. Like, say, that this problem is not Apple’s fault, but is instead related to the use of APE, a totally unsupported system hack that messes with running applications. A hack that people have been specifically warned not to use.
Although, in a move which I find somewhat amusing, Apple refuses to refer to the problem as a “Blue Screen of Death”. Apparently they find the term, historically associated with Windows, somewhat distasteful. Instead, Apple simply uses the term “Blue Screen”. The problem is recognized by Apple on this support page. On the far right, there’s a link entitled “Blue screen after installing”. Apple’s automatically generated top searches also shows the # 1 search to be ” ‘Blue screen’ appears after install”. A Mac user in this thread actually had the audacity to use the term “Blue Screen of Death” in a post, which ultimately led to him or her being referred to as a “crackpot” by the Apple faithful.
Gee, I wonder why that can be. Could it be because not every blue screen is the “Blue Screen of Death”? Could it be because the term “Blue Screen Of Death” is used to describe a specific error screen on Windows, and Apple does not want to confuse the users with incorrect terminology in a support forum? Why does Apple use the term “blue screen” then? Well, because it’s a blue screen, Serlock. It’s not a shortened version of the Windows term, it’s a description of what users see when they encounter the problem.
Leopard has been plagued by a series of other problems as well. There are graphics artifacts followed by freezes, which may be caused by the new operating system’s increased use of the Mac graphics card.
Don’t you love how a bug in the graphic drivers is described as being probably caused by “the new operating system’s increased use of the Mac graphics card”. Gives it an aura of permanence, doesn’t it?
There are also two bugs in the usually trouble-free Mac firewall. The first caused the firewall to be installed turned off by default, which some Mac users didn’t find out about until they ran into problems. The second refused to allow some third party applications to access the Internet, including, of all things, World of Warcraft. Yeah, that’ll be good for building support among gamers! The OSX 10.5.1 update claims to have firewall fixes, but again, it’s not specific as to whether these particular issues have been addressed.
And, once again, you can’t be bothered to check.
There are a variety of other reports, including a Mac Pro becoming completely inoperative after a Leopard upgrade. One user asked, Is it me, or is Leopard just a mess?.
It must be him, because, emm, it works fine for millions of other people. Like those million buyers in it’s first week.
Or, it could actually be that, as every software release, it has its’ issues, its’ share of bugs and all, that will be ironed out with subsequent point releases.
Another user echoed my sentiments at the start of this article by asking Is ANY part of Leopard ready for release? Worst product from Apple so far. Here’s a shock, the entire thread was censored.
And this is shocking how? Does such sensationalist talking on a support forum help address the specific issues people have? Does it help iron out bugs on 10.5.1 or 10.5.2?
And amazingly, despite all of the above, and everything else we’ve seen go wrong since Leopard debuted 3 weeks ago, at apple.com/mac/, an Apple ad on the left side of the page says “Leopard just works”.
Well, it does. Doesn’t it?
Let’s see what you have gathered so far:
1) A bug that existed since Panther, affects only a 0.001% of users that use an obscure Finder feature and has been fixed on 10.5.1.
2) A problem with some Seagate HDs, having nothing to do with Leopard.
3) A blue screen problem for users using the totally unsupported, system botching hack that is APE (one that can be solved following Apple’s instructions to remove APE).
4) The firewall turned off by default and blocking World of Warcraft.
5) A bug in the graphics drivers affecting some iMacs.
If those are Leopard’s “serious problems” then we got a winner OS here!
I have previously posted a collection of tips about fixing the Leopard ugliness (you know, the 3D dock, the Stacks and the transparent menubar).
The Mac community had been hard at work on the meantime, producing some even better tips to replace some of the previous kludgy solutions.
JWZ, of Netscape/Mozilla fame, offers some tips on how to “de-lamify your dock and menubar”. He provides tips for making the Dock stick to the side of the screen (instead of dead center) and for turning off menubar transparency.
There is an even better tip for turning off the menubar transparency than enables you to choose your own shade for the dock. Simply use the command specified on macosxhints but substitute the 1 at then end with your own decimal value between 0 and 1 (the bigger, the more white the menubar will be). 0.62 gets you nice shade of gray like the one Apple uses on old PPC machines.
I am a little worried about using this tip myself. It sets a specific preference on WindowServer, but my understanding is that WindowServer is responsible for all windows, not just the menubar. Could this setting affect other aspects of the windowing system? Like, say, some translucent windows not showing correctly? Until we here more about this, I’m hesitant to take the leap.
This thing is ugly.
Also, doomed.
Not wanting to be tagged as a Photoshop lover or an Adobe shill (I’m referring to my previous post), here is a recount of me trying to be kept up to date with the latest Adobe wares.
As you probably already know, last Friday (11/16) Adobe issued some updates to Camera Raw and Photoshop Lightroom programs. Good luck trying to download them or find any useful information about them.
I know what you’re thinking. “I’ll go visit the website”. No word on the front page about any updates.
Well, there must be something on the Downloads page. Let’s see, there’s an “Updates” option in the Downloads menu. It has to be here, right? And, sure enought, it is. We see a listing for “Adobe Photoshop Lightroom 1.3 Update - November 16, 2007″, complete with links for the Windows and Macintosh version. Yeah! Let’s now click on the Macintosh link.
It takes us here. Hey, where’s our 1.3 update? All we can see in this page is the older 1.2 update. Damn.
Maybe we’ll have better luck with the Camera Raw update. Back to Downloads -> Updates we go. Here is is. “Camera Raw 4.3 update, November 16, 2007″. Let’s click the Macintosh link below it. Hmmm. Interesting. It changes under our feet,
through an internal direct from:
http://www.adobe.com/support/downloads/detail.jsp?ftpID=3821
to:
http://www.adobe.com/downloads/?notFoundID=null
Which leaves us on the main Downloads page with the listing of every product.
Change of strategy. Maybe we can find a link to the updates from the product page. Let’s visit http://www.adobe.com/ap/products/photoshoplightroom/. Sure enough, here’s a link for the mythical “Lightroom 1.3 Update”. We hesitantly click on the Macintosh link next to it. Ah, the good old http://www.adobe.com/downloads/?notFoundID=null page.
Touch luck. It seems that there are no updates for us today (or any of the four previous days, for that matter).
With some Adobe stuff, you can use Adobe Updater to, em, update it. A fine piece of software that does not play well with FileVault and chokes your system to 100% CPU (seehere, screenshot included).
Not that Adobe sits on its hands. It suggests, and I kid you not, this solution:
Solution 1: Change the Adobe Updater preferences to not check for updates. If your computer is connected to the internet, then you can change the Adobe Updater preferences to not check for updates.
Solution 2: Edit the AdobeUpdaterPrefs settings file. If your computer does not have an internet connection, then you can manually edit the AdobeUpdaterPreferences.dat file. (…) If the
1 tag already exists, thenchange the value from 1 to 0. Otherwise, add the line0 anywhere between thetags. Solution 3: Disable the Updater.api plug-in. (…) Rename the Updater.api plug-in to Updater.api.old
Those are the Windows “solutions”. I guess something similar exists for the Mac. Good luck trying to find it.
It’s not that Adobe doesn’t know about those issues. It might be that, with no competitors and all, it just can’t be bothered.
For example, the Lightroom Journal, hosted on Adobe by Lightroom stuff, aknowlegdes the problem with the broken links et al and even provides an alternative download method (via ftp). Still, 4 full days later Adobe’s page remains erratic.